Class JobsGrpc


  • @Generated(value="by gRPC proto compiler",
               comments="Source: google/cloud/run/v2/job.proto")
    public final class JobsGrpc
    extends Object
     Cloud Run Job Control Plane API.
     
    • Method Detail

      • getCreateJobMethod

        public static io.grpc.MethodDescriptor<CreateJobRequest,​com.google.longrunning.Operation> getCreateJobMethod()
      • getGetJobMethod

        public static io.grpc.MethodDescriptor<GetJobRequest,​Job> getGetJobMethod()
      • getUpdateJobMethod

        public static io.grpc.MethodDescriptor<UpdateJobRequest,​com.google.longrunning.Operation> getUpdateJobMethod()
      • getDeleteJobMethod

        public static io.grpc.MethodDescriptor<DeleteJobRequest,​com.google.longrunning.Operation> getDeleteJobMethod()
      • getRunJobMethod

        public static io.grpc.MethodDescriptor<RunJobRequest,​com.google.longrunning.Operation> getRunJobMethod()
      • getGetIamPolicyMethod

        public static io.grpc.MethodDescriptor<com.google.iam.v1.GetIamPolicyRequest,​com.google.iam.v1.Policy> getGetIamPolicyMethod()
      • getSetIamPolicyMethod

        public static io.grpc.MethodDescriptor<com.google.iam.v1.SetIamPolicyRequest,​com.google.iam.v1.Policy> getSetIamPolicyMethod()
      • getTestIamPermissionsMethod

        public static io.grpc.MethodDescriptor<com.google.iam.v1.TestIamPermissionsRequest,​com.google.iam.v1.TestIamPermissionsResponse> getTestIamPermissionsMethod()
      • newStub

        public static JobsGrpc.JobsStub newStub​(io.grpc.Channel channel)
        Creates a new async stub that supports all call types for the service
      • newBlockingStub

        public static JobsGrpc.JobsBlockingStub newBlockingStub​(io.grpc.Channel channel)
        Creates a new blocking-style stub that supports unary and streaming output calls on the service
      • newFutureStub

        public static JobsGrpc.JobsFutureStub newFutureStub​(io.grpc.Channel channel)
        Creates a new ListenableFuture-style stub that supports unary calls on the service
      • bindService

        public static final io.grpc.ServerServiceDefinition bindService​(JobsGrpc.AsyncService service)
      • getServiceDescriptor

        public static io.grpc.ServiceDescriptor getServiceDescriptor()